Q: How to Service the Front Brake Disc on 2004 Dodge Ram 2500?
A: For front brake disc service, you must first support the vehicle, then remove the wheel and tire assembly. Then, disconnect the caliper from the steering knuckle and remove the caliper adapter assembly while ensuring the brake hose doesn't hold it up. Take out the disc from its place around the hub/bearing wheel studs. If your car has all-wheel Antilock System (ABS) and you spot damage on the tone wheel, replace the entire hub/bearing assembly since the tone wheel cannot be serviced alone. Secure the disc to the studs on the hub/bearing wheel and place and secure the caliper adapter assembly, tightening all adapter bolts. Mount the wheel and tire assembly, set the vehicle back down, push the brakes a few times to set the pads and test it before driving off.
